Deploy step 4 — FareLab pricing experiment

Alright, once the canary for the ticket-pricing experiment is green on the Bramblegate venue cluster, flip EXPERIMENT_FARELAB=on in the app's env file. Don't enable it fleet-wide yet — pricing math gets weird without the variant service. That service won't answer unless it can authenticate, so right under the experiment flag add this line:

env line for haweg-hahop: RELAY_SECRET8=0e1275cd

This fragment covers account recovery when the flaky resolver at the Bramwick site intermittently fails to resolve the Tessera identity endpoint. First confirm the failure is DNS, not auth: check the resolver logs for SERVFAIL entries before touching any account state. If recovery is genuinely needed, initiate it from the fallback console, which will prompt for the recovery passphrase recorded just below this line.

vault phrase of bagaf-kajeg = jorath-feniel-briir-siliel-ralix

INTERNAL MEMO — Heads of Department

Following Treasury's review, Bravenholt Group will hedge 70% of projected veldmark exposure for the next four quarters using forward contracts rather than options, reducing premium costs while accepting limited upside. Finance will report hedge effectiveness monthly. This decision connects directly to our broader positioning, which I must share with you in confidence below.

internal memo for kahop-yajof: The steering committee signed off on a budget of $12.6 million for Project Jorwyn. The renewal with Quenoxox Logistics closes at $16.8 million a year, 48 percent above the last contract.

Action item: The Relayn deploy-status bot silently dropped updates when the pipeline API paginated results, so responders believed a rollback had completed when it had not. We will add pagination handling, a staleness banner, and an integration test. Until merged, verify deploy state directly in the pipeline console, documented at the page below.

runbook for kahop-kajop: https://rundeck.ordinio.test/display/secrets/pipeline/issue/pages/repo/browse/e5732776e07d1285107e5aeb